What is Google TV?
Google TV is a smart TV platform developed by Google that serves as a centralized interface for accessing a variety of streaming services and apps. Unlike the former Google Play Movies & TV, Google TV offers a unified experience, allowing users to find and watch content from different providers in one place.
Google TV Initial Setup
Setting up Google TV is a simple and straightforward process. All you need is a Google account and a compatible TV. Follow the steps below to get started:
- Connect your Google TV device: Connect your Google TV device to your TV via the HDMI port.
- Turn on the TV: Turn on the TV and select the corresponding HDMI input.
- Initial setup: Follow the on-screen instructions to connect your device to the internet and sign in with your Google account.
- Personalization: Personalize your home screen by adding your favorite streaming services.
Tips and Tricks to Get the Most Out of Google TV
- Customize the Home Screen: Add or remove apps as you prefer to keep your home screen organized.
- Use Voice Control: With the Google Assistant built-in, you can use voice commands to search for content, adjust settings, or even control smart devices around your home.
- Create User Profiles: If you have multiple people in your household using Google TV, create user profiles so each person has their own personalized recommendations.
- Update Regularly: Keep your Google TV software and apps up to date to ensure the best performance and access to the latest features.
